From 0f2ef356d62d17fd254b440a718bde5258840792 Mon Sep 17 00:00:00 2001 From: Viktor Barzin Date: Sun, 5 Apr 2026 23:53:18 +0300 Subject: [PATCH] fix: remove ISCSICSIControllerDown alert (democratic-csi decommissioned) iSCSI CSI (democratic-csi) was replaced by proxmox-csi in April 2026. Controller is intentionally scaled to 0. Remove the stale alert and update CSIDriverCrashLoop to monitor proxmox-csi instead of iscsi-csi. --- .../modules/monitoring/prometheus_chart_values.tpl |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/stacks/monitoring/modules/monitoring/prometheus_chart_values.tpl b/stacks/monitoring/modules/monitoring/prometheus_chart_values.tpl index 4951d2d1..8098cf04 100755 --- a/stacks/monitoring/modules/monitoring/prometheus_chart_values.tpl +++ b/stacks/monitoring/modules/monitoring/prometheus_chart_values.tpl @@ -1060,7 +1060,7 @@ serverFiles: annotations: summary: "Cloud Sync task {{ $labels.task_id }} last state was not SUCCESS" - alert: CSIDriverCrashLoop - expr: kube_pod_container_status_waiting_reason{reason="CrashLoopBackOff", namespace=~"nfs-csi|iscsi-csi"} > 0 + expr: kube_pod_container_status_waiting_reason{reason="CrashLoopBackOff", namespace=~"nfs-csi|proxmox-csi"} > 0 for: 10m labels: severity: critical @@ -1484,13 +1484,7 @@ serverFiles: severity: critical annotations: summary: "NFS CSI controller down — new NFS volume provisioning broken" - - alert: ISCSICSIControllerDown - expr: (kube_deployment_status_replicas_available{namespace="iscsi-csi", deployment="democratic-csi-iscsi-controller"} or on() vector(0)) < 1 - for: 5m - labels: - severity: critical - annotations: - summary: "iSCSI CSI controller down — new iSCSI volume provisioning broken" + # ISCSICSIControllerDown alert removed — democratic-csi replaced by proxmox-csi (2026-04-05) - name: "Application Health" rules: - alert: MailServerDown